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
1 HOME MEADOW MEWS Detached £680,000 12 Oct 2010
2 HOME MEADOW MEWS Semi-Detached £680,000 17 Nov 2010
3 HOME MEADOW MEWS Terraced £665,000 18 Apr 2012
4 HOME MEADOW MEWS Terraced £1,200,000 5 Jul 2023
5 HOME MEADOW MEWS Terraced £304,391 6 Sep 2011